This bar, located in Charleston, South Carolina, is a hip American spot that’s become a favorite among locals and visitors looking for a stellar dining experience with their furry friends in tow. Tucked away just a block off the bustling King Street corridor, this dog friendly bar offers a refreshing escape from the crowds while keeping you connected to Charleston’s vibrant downtown energy.
The real draw here is the thoughtfully designed outdoor space. This dog friendly bar features both an open-air patio and a covered section, so you and your pup can enjoy a meal regardless of the weather. The leafy surroundings create a genuinely relaxing atmosphere that makes you feel like you’ve discovered a hidden gem, even though it’s right in the heart of the action. People who visit this dog friendly bar consistently praise how welcoming the staff is to both two-legged and four-legged guests alike.
If you’re a cocktail enthusiast, you’re in for a treat. This dog friendly bar boasts an impressive craft cocktail menu backed by servers who actually know their stuff and can guide you through the options with genuine expertise. Beyond the drinks, the food program is equally impressive. Contemporary American dishes are prepared with care, featuring balanced flavors and fresh ingredients. Visitors appreciate that everything from the small plates to the full entrees demonstrates real culinary attention. The dessert selection is also noteworthy if you’re looking to end your meal on a sweet note.
This dog friendly bar caters to a diverse crowd, from solo diners to groups and tourists exploring Charleston’s food scene. The vibe walks that perfect line between casual and upscale—cozy enough that you don’t feel overdressed, but polished enough to feel special. They also offer happy hour drinks and food, making it a solid option for a relaxed evening without breaking the bank. With full reservation capabilities and a range of service options including dine-in, takeout, and delivery, this dog friendly bar makes it easy to experience what they’re all about, whether you’re sitting at a table with your pup or grabbing something to go.
